For people who use Windows-based screen readers, there are several free options available. Both NVDA and Windows Narrator have significantly improved over the past several years. These programs offer features and functionality that make them viable options when working in some common Windows applications, such as Microsoft Office. This session will explore both of these programs, highlight some of the latest improvements, and show how they can be used to gain meaningful access in widely used Windows apps.
